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Aylesbury to Thetford start from as little as £22.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Aylesbury to Thetford start from £83.10 one way, or £84.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Aylesbury to Thetford are available for £109.10 one way, or £165.30 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Everything you need to know about Thetford Station

Discover Thetford Train Station

Nestled within the serene surroundings of Norfolk, Thetford Railway Station offers a charming slice of the British rail experience. Whether you're a seasoned commuter or planning a leisurely journey across the East of England, Thetford acts as a vital hub connecting you to bustling urban centres and quaint countryside escapes alike. Here, we delve into the ins and outs of Thetford station's offerings, helping you make the most of your travel plans.

Facilities and Amenities

Thetford train station is equipped to cater to your ticket purchasing needs with its ticket office open every weekday and Saturday from 07:00 to 13:30. Even if the office is closed, ticket machines are available, and they are accessible to assist all travellers, providing the convenience to collect tickets purchased online. The presence of an induction loop ensures that those with hearing impairments can stay informed.

While the station currently lacks on-site dining and shopping options, this shortfall is compensated by its focus on accessibility. Step-free access to Platform 2 is available for journeys towards Ely and Cambridge, while a footpath from Croxton Road ensures access to Platform 1 for services heading to Norwich. The station's bicycle facilities include both sheltered standings and CCTV for added security.

Accessible Travel and Support

Accessibility is a priority at Thetford Station. It is equipped with ramps for train access, on-hand wheelchairs, and dedicated customer help points. Although accessible toilets are not available, the station strives to support passengers with mobility needs. It’s categorized as a B2 station by the Office of Rail and Road, highlighting its partial accessibility and proactive assistance approaches.

Getting to and from the Station

Thetford station provides a well-integrated link to various transport modes, ensuring smooth transitions for your onward journey. Rail replacement bus services, situated in the heart of the station's car park, cater for those times when rail services are disrupted. While car hire services are absent, the station's bike storage and taxi access ensure versatility in travel options.

Thetford Station is a focal point for those wanting to explore East Anglia, boasting unique features like its proximity to the beautiful Thetford Forest, ideal for outdoor enthusiasts. Since 1844, the station has been part of the UK’s rich rail history, now managed by Greater Anglia, providing reliable services across the region.
